JavaScript
- 24 ответа
- 0 вопросов
20
Вклад в тег
<!DOCTYPE html>
<html>
<head>
<title></title>
<style type="text/css">
.block {
width: 190px;
height: 40px;
background-color: red;
border: 1px solid black;
}
</style>
</head>
<body>
<div class="block"></div>
<div class="block"></div>
<div class="block"></div>
<div class="block"></div>
<div class="block"></div>
<div class="block"></div>
<script type="text/javascript">
"use strict";
let blocks = Array.from(document.querySelectorAll(".block"));
let widthBlock = getComputedStyle(blocks[0]).width.slice(0, -2);
for (let i = 0; i < blocks.length; i++) blocks[i].style.width = +widthBlock + 20 * i + "px";
</script>
</body>
</html>
"use strict";
//Заполнение таблицы в модальном окне
$(document).ready(function() {
$(".tckttbl").dblclick(function() {
clear_modal(); //Очистка можно так же циклом, принцип показал ниже
var col_arr = []; //Иницализация масива
var rowData = $(this).children(); //Получаем кучу <td> из тега <tr>
for (var i = 0; i < $(this).children().length; i++) {
//Засовываем значения в масив для более удобной работы с ними
col_arr.push($(rowData[i]).text());
}
console.log(col_arr); //Выводит значения стобцов
// for (var i = 0; i <= col_arr.length; i++) {
// //Вместо имени можешь использовать data тэг и радоваться жизни
// $('input[name=col_' + (Number(i) + 1) + ']').val(col_arr[i]);
// }
// Или так если не динамическая таблица
$('tr #decl').text(col_arr[0]);
$('tr #exec').text(col_arr[1]);
$('tr #stag').text(col_arr[2]);
$("#idModalView").modal('show');
});
function clear_modal() { // Очистка модального окна
$('td[id=decl]').val("");
$('td[id=exec]').val("");
$('td[id=stag]').val("");
}
$(".filter__item").hover(function () {
// Первая функция при наведении.
let dataImage = $(this).children(".filter__image").attr('data-image');
let image = $(this).find(".filter__image img");
image.attr("data-src", image.attr("src"));
image.attr("src", dataImage);
}, function() {
// Вторая функция при отводе.
let image = $(this).find(".filter__image img");
image.attr("src", image.attr("data-src"));
});
<!DOCTYPE html>
<html>
<head>
<title></title>
<script type="text/javascript">
"use strict";
if (window.screen.width < 1280) {
window.stop();
}
</script>
</head>
<body>
<div style="width: 100px; height: 100px;" class="btn">STOP</div>
Lorem ipsum dolor sit amet, consectetuer adipiscing elit. Aenean commodo ligula eget dolor. Aenean massa. Cum sociis natoque penatibus et magnis dis parturient montes, nascetur ridiculus mus. Donec quam felis, ultricies nec, pellentesque eu, pretium quis, sem. Nulla consequat massa quis enim. Donec pede justo, fringilla vel, aliquet nec, vulputate eget, arcu. In enim justo, rhoncus ut, imperdiet a, venenatis vitae, justo. Nullam dictum felis eu pede mollis pretium.
</body>
</html>